What is Medicare Application Form?

The Medicare Application Form is a document that individuals need to complete in order to enroll in the Medicare program. Medicare is a federal health insurance program in the United States that helps people who are 65 or older, as well as certain younger individuals with disabilities, to cover their medical expenses.

What are the types of Medicare Application Form?

There are different types of Medicare Application Forms depending on the specific situation of the individual. The most common types include the Medicare Part A Application, the Medicare Part B Application, the Medicare Advantage Plan Enrollment Form, and the Medicare Prescription Drug Coverage Enrollment Form. Each form serves a different purpose and requires specific information to be completed successfully.

How to complete Medicare Application Form

Completing the Medicare Application Form is an important step to access the benefits of the program. Here is a step-by-step guide to help you complete the form:

01
Gather necessary documents such as proof of age, citizenship, and any other relevant documentation.
02
Ensure you have accurate information about your current health insurance coverage.
03
Carefully review the form instructions and fill in all required fields.
04
Double-check all the provided information for accuracy and completeness.
05
Submit the completed form through the designated channels.

By following these steps, you will ensure that your Medicare Application Form is completed correctly and increase your chances of receiving the benefits you are entitled to.

Medicare will enroll you in Part B automatically. Your Medicare card will be mailed to you about 3 months before your 65th birthday. If you're not getting disability benefits and Medicare when you turn 65, you'll need to call or visit your local Social Security office, or call Social Security at 1-800-772-1213.
You will have a Medicare initial enrollment period. If you sign up for Medicare Part A and Part B during the first three months of your initial enrollment period, your coverage will start on the first day of the month you turn 65.

You get Part A automatically. If you want Part B, you need to sign up for it. If you don't sign up for Part B within 3 months of turning 65, you might have to wait to sign up and pay a monthly late enrollment penalty.
